For those who were left hanging and curious about the epic Battle of Axanar, the significant turning point in the war against the Klingon Empire, a new yet unofficial movie is currently in the works. Titled as "Star Trek: Axanar", the upcoming film will give the fans a closer look to what really happened at Axanar, and how Captain Garth achieved victory in the said encounter.

To stir the excitement of the "Star Trek" fans, Robert Meyer Burnett, who is producing the movie and just recently took over the director's chair, has teased some information regarding the forthcoming film. While "Prelude to Axanar" and the notion of "The Four Years War" were absolutely inspired by the FASA sourcebook for the STAR TREK role playing game, we're sticking as close as we can to the events depicted in the original series and not referencing the RPG or any of the books and comics that have been written," he told Io9. "Aside from Garth and Ambassador Soval, all of our characters are completely original, as are the situations presented in the film".

Yahoo notes that the event was briefly mentioned in the original "Star Trek" series back in 1960s, but the battle itself was never featured solely on screen. The event was also reportedly cited in the original series' third-season episode, "Whom Gods Destroy," which followed battle winner and Starfleet captain Garth of Izar.

According to the filmmaker, "Star Trek: Axanar" will be providing the awesome starship combat the franchise's fans have been requesting but will prioritizing the story of its characters first."But make no mistake, the film is, first and foremost, about our characters. The very last thing I'm interested in is making a pew, pew, pew STAR TREK movie," he explained.

As per Wired's report, the forthcoming film follows the story of the ultimate battle in the war between the Klingon Empire and the Federation. Set roughly two decades prior to Captain Kirk's ruling over the Enterprise, "Star Trek: Axanar" pits Commander Kharn (not Khan), a new Klingon character, against the leading Federation commander, Garth of Izar.

The project is currently funded through a series of Kickstarter campaigns. It is slated to hold a third crowdfunding campaign soon, to raise badly needed funds to complete the production. It is currently in pre-production stage now with a target filming date of October 2015.

"Star Trek: Axanar" is slated to be released in the first half of 2016.
